This is a great App that is based on principles of adult learning: repetition, variety, randomness and self-pacing. Words you've learned reappear at a reduced frequency. Words that you are still learning re-appear more frequently. Want words in one language, or the reverse-- that's easy. Want them randomly mixed in not languages, that's easy too. Synching between devices makes the app versatile and device friendly. Highly recommended.
